Last year in my Skol Vikings post I listed 3 questions that needed to be answered for us to have a good season. Needless to say they were all answered in a negative fashion.
1. AP didn't stay healthy.
2. Ponder wasn't the answer.
3. Our secondary was really really bad
At the end of last season I thought Frazier should have been given another year just like AP did. The way things have worked out with us getting Zimmer and Turner I am glad now that we didn't. I am really hopeful that Zimmer is going to turn things around.
Here are my 3 questions for this year for the Vikings to have a good year.
1. Can Zimmer bring the defense back to respectability? With the way our season starts with games against New England, Saints, Packers, and Atlanta we our going to need it and need it fast. If we can force turnovers like we did this preseason then our D should be good to go.
2. Can our O Line keep Cassel upright and give AP room to roam? Last year O Line play was highly inconsistent. We need Kalil to return to Pro Bowl form.
3. Can AP stay healthy and win another rushing title? I know Norv wants to spread the ball around and get AP involved in the passing game, so maybe a rushing title is asking for a bit much; But you can't put anything past what AP can do if he's healthy. Whatever happens as long as AP is getting the rock a lot, I'm OK with it.
Prediction for the year: I think we win at least 7 games minimum and possibly 11 if everything falls our way. If we can start 2-0 then everybody in our division better be on notice.

Vikes- What I think they should do now.
The Vikings made the decision to rush Josh Freeman out to see what he could do versus the New York Giants on Monday Night Football. If you didn't see the game, then you are lucky, because it was Uuuugly!!! Josh was obviously not ready to play for us yet. He needs more time to learn the system. He needs to get his mechanics fixed. And he needs to get his head right. If I were the Vikings Management and Coaches I would sit Freeman for our next three games minimum. I would start Ponder verses Green Bay next week and put Cassel as back up. That is what I think they should do now.

My Thought On The Vikings Going Into The Bye
Well the 1st quarter of the season is in the books and the Vikes are lucky to not be 0-4 and unlucky to not be 3-1. I will say this: the Browns were NOT who we thought they were. Unfortunately we can't say the same thing about Ponder and our pass defense. They are the two biggest reason's we are not 3-1. Ponder has improved a little bit, but his turnovers have just killed us. However, our porous Defense is the biggest reason we are not 3-1. There is no way in heck we should have given up 31 points to the Browns at home. There is little doubt at this point that we finish last in the North unless the Defense improves markedly. I see no reason to be optimistic about that happening.
As far as Ponder versus Cassel, I think Ponder should ride the bench for a while. Let him learn from Cassel. I don't know that the Vikes have to give up on Ponder totally at this point. He wasn't the only reason our Offense was struggled at times the first 3 weeks of the season. There are times when Ponder flashes, but he is just too inconsistent. Our Offensive line really struggled against the Lions, Bears, and Browns. Having Jerome Felton back makes a big difference in Peterson's play and no doubt the whole O line's play as well. To me Felton's presence was as the big a factor in the win as Cassel. I think had Felton been able to play the first three games we might have won both the Bears and Browns game.
I say let Cassel play and see where it takes us. With our D, I don't think it will be very far. If he can't take us beyond a .500 record over the next two quarters of the season then they should re-insert Ponder for the last 4 games of the season and see if he cleaned up his game. If not it's time for a new QB plan next year.
